Public Swim Begins Next Week at Gora Aquatic Center

May 15, 2025 10:02AM ● By MPG Staff
GALT, CA (MPG) - The Gora Aquatic Center will reopen for public swim beginning Saturday, May 24, according to a City of Galt news release, offering residents weekend access to the pool from 2 p.m. to 7 p.m. on Saturdays and Sundays through June 8, with additional hours on Memorial Day, Monday, May 26. The early summer schedule provides ample space for families and individuals to enjoy open swim sessions, lap lanes and shaded relaxation areas.

In addition to public swim, the center’s spring lineup includes water aerobics strength and conditioning classes, swim lessons for all ages and abilities, dedicated lap swim periods and youth competitive opportunities through the Galt Gators Swim Team. 

Residents may register for all programs online at cityofgalt.org/parksandrecreation or in person at the Parks and Recreation office, Monday through Thursday. Program fees vary by activity, and financial assistance options are available for qualifying families.

Full summer hours and special event schedules, including evening swims, themed family nights and swim team showcase meets, will be announced on the city’s website and social media channels in the coming weeks.

Schools Out Program Registration Now Open 
Registrations are now open for the 2025 CAMP SOAR (School’s Out Academic and Recreation Program), an eight week day camp running from June 9 through Aug. 1. 

The program requires in person registration on a first come, first served basis and features a different theme each week, along with arts and crafts, outdoor play, group games and supervised pool time at the Gora Aquatic Center.

Camp SOAR themes are scheduled as follows: Nature Explorers (June 9–13); Science (June 16–20, no camp on June 19); STEM (June 23–27); Ocean Adventures (June 30–July 3, no camp on July 4); Teamwork (July 7–11); Superhero Week (July 14–18); The Wild West (July 21–25); and Marketland (July 28–Aug. 1).

Program fees range from $45 to $165 per week, depending on selected options. A completed registration form and payment must be submitted before attendance. 

Parents and guardians may register in person at the Parks and Recreation office, 610 Chabolla Ave., Monday through Thursday between 8 a.m. and 5:30 p.m.; the office is closed Fridays and major holidays.

Summer Reading Challenge Signups Offered
The Galt Library’s annual Summer Reading Challenge begins May 15, inviting readers of all ages to log their summer reading via the Beanstack platform to earn virtual badges and real world prizes.

Participants may register themselves or multiple household members on Beanstack.com or by downloading the Beanstack app on any mobile device. Those who prefer offline tracking can pick up a paper log at any library location. 

Beginning June 1, each book read and each completed activity earns 100 points; readers log titles and tasks to accumulate points toward rewards.

Youth readers who reach 500 points or log five books will receive one free book of their choice, valid for the first five titles or 500 points. 

Adult participants who meet the same thresholds will earn a coupon redeemable for one free book at the Book Den, plus an enamel pin or tote bag. 

All participants who log 2,500 points or 25 books will be awarded a Summer Reading medal.
The challenge runs through the end of summer, with badges unlocking as readers complete themed activities and log their progress. 

Library staff encourage early sign-up, noting that prizes are available on a first come, first served basis.
